Well, at least Erin, Larry Kudlow, Jim Cramer and the rest of CNBC's cast of white dwarfs will not be discussing one thing in detail -- their parent company is not exactly doing well, dragged down by its own faulty financial department, G.E. Capital...

the company’s stock, which had been $17 a share just a couple of months ago, dropped to under $6
But don't worry...GE knows what CNBC is good for and it isn't journalism:
On Thursday morning, the company’s chief financial officer, Keith Sherin, appeared on CNBC, which G.E. conveniently owns, and offered a passionate defense of the company.
And why would his employees challenge him? That would be like disclosing GE's defense industry connections when reporting on the Pentagon budget, which just isn't done.
